- Make sure your skin is clean, entirely dry and free from grease. Do not use any cream before

you start epilating.

- Epilation is easier and more comfortable when the hair has the optimum length of 3–4 mm. If

the hairs are longer, we recommend that you shave first and epilate the shorter regrowing hairs

after 1 or 2 weeks. You can also use the sensitive area shaving head with the trimming comb to

pretrim hairs to this ideal length (HP6572 only).

- As your hair grows in different cycles, it is best to epilate a few days in a row when you start

epilating. This will help you to remain stubble-free longer because your hairs will start regrowing

in the same cycle and pace.

- The epilator is delivered with the basic epilation cap attached. If you want to use it with the

optimal performance cap or the active hairlifter with active massage, detach the basic epilation

cap by pulling it off the appliance and attach the optimal performance cap or the active hairlifter

with active massage (see chapter ‘Using the epilator’, section ‘Epilating the legs with the epilator’).
During epilation

- While epilating, stretch your skin with your free hand. This lifts up the hairs and helps to

minimise the pulling sensation.

- For optimal performance, place the epilating head on the skin at an angle of 90° with the on/off

button pointing in the direction in which you are going to move the appliance. Guide the

appliance across the skin against the direction of hair growth in a slow, continuous movement

without exerting any pressure.

- On some areas, hair may grow in different directions. In this case, it may be helpful to move the

appliance in different directions to achieve optimal results.

- If you sweat during epilation, dab your skin dry with a soft cloth.

- When you use the optimal performance cap, make sure that both rollers of the skin stretcher

always stay in contact with the skin to ensure an optimal result.

- When you use the active hairlifter with active massage, make sure the active massaging roller

and the active hairlifter always stay in contact with the skin. The massaging roller stimulates and

relaxes the skin for a gentler epilation.
after epilation

- To relax the skin, we advise you to apply a moisturising cream immediately after epilation or a

few hours after epilation, depending on what is better for your skin.

- Regular use of an exfoliating sponge or cream (e.g. during showering) 24 hours after epilation

helps to prevent ingrowing hair, as the gentle scrubbing action removes the upper skin layer and

fine hair can get through to the skin surface.

Epilating the legs with the epilator

- If you already have some experience with epilation, you can simply use the epilating head with

the basic epilation cap.

- If you are not used to epilation, we advise you to start epilating with the optimal performance

cap. This cap ensures optimal skin contact and its pivoting head stretches the skin and prepares

the hairs for epilation.

- If your hairs lie flat on your skin, we advise you to use the active hairlifter with active massage.

The active hairlifter with active massage not only lifts up the hairs but its active massaging roller

also minimises the pulling sensation of epilation.

Note: Remove the basic epilation cap before you attach the optimal performance cap or the active

hairlifter with active massage.
